China constituted the country with the largest volume of silicates consumption, accounting for 24% of total volume. Moreover, silicates consumption in China ex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est consumer, the United States, threefold. India ranked third in terms of total consumption with a 6.9% share.
China remains the largest silicates producing country worldwide, accounting for 27% of total volume. Moreover, silicates production in China ex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est producer, the United States, fourfold. India ranked third in terms of total production with a 5.1% share.
In value terms, Spain constituted the largest supplier of silicates, commercial alkali metal silicates to France, comprising 45%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by the Netherlands, with a 13% share of total imports. It was followed by Belgium, with a 13% share.
In value terms, the largest markets for silicates exported from France were Germany, the Netherlands and Italy, together comprising 28% of total exports. Switzerland, Luxembourg, Turkey, Spain and Belgium l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further 20%.
In 2022, the average silicates export price amounted to $644 per ton, increasing by 45% against the previous year.
The average silicates import price stood at $427 per ton in 2022, rising by 13% against the previous year.
